Long-standing disagreements concerning prehispanic Maya kinship and social organization have focused on the nature of their corporate groups, generally presumed to have been lineages. Specific debates center on whether the lineages were patrilineal or incorporated some kind of double-descent reckoning, how descent was combined with locality to define a group, and the status of lineage-outsiders within a group. It is argued here that Maya social organization is better approached within the contemporary critique of kinship, replacing "lineage" with Lévi-Strauss's model of the "house"—a corporate group maintaining an estate perpetuated by the recruitment of members whose relationships are expressed "in the language" of kinship and affinity and affirmed by purposeful actions. In this perspective, the operation of corporate groups is the primary concern, and relationships construed in terms of consanguinity and affinity are seen as strategies pursued to enhance and perpetuate the group, [ancestor veneration, house society, kinship, Maya, social organization]  相似文献

Ly-1 B helper cells in autoimmune "viable motheaten" mice   总被引:2,自引:0,他引:2  
Previous work has demonstrated that Ly-1 B cells from normal C57BL/6J mice help the response of B cell subsets to the 4-hydroxy-3-nitrophenylacetyl hapten (NP). This regulatory cell population, called BH, preferentially helps the expression of plaque-forming B cells which express a predominant set of serologically related determinants collectively known as the NPb idiotype family. The specificity of BH cell activity in the NP system is a reflection of NPb idiotype-specific BH cell surface receptors. Thus, BH cells recognize autologous (i.e., idiotype) antigens. Given these observations and previous associations of increased Ly-1 B cell frequency in autoimmune mice, it was hypothesized that autoreactive Ly-1 BH cells may be present in high frequencies and in an activated state in autoimmune mice. To test this hypothesis the immunologic activity of BH cells in autoimmune viable motheaten (mev/mev) mice was studied. It was determined that splenic BH cells are approximately 10 times more frequent in viable motheaten than normal mice. The fact that BH cells from viable motheaten mice are activated was suggested by the presence of NPb idiotype-specific BH replacing helper activity in sera or B cell supernatants from these autoimmune mice. The soluble helper activities constitutively produced in mev/mev splenic B cell cultures and detected in mev/mev serum were resolved into two moieties, an NPb idiotype-specific immunoglobulin and a nonimmunoglobulin lymphokine(s) fraction. Purified mev/mev B cell-derived B cell maturation factor could substitute for the lymphokine moiety in the NPb idiotype helper cell assay. These results suggest that at least two signals, anti-idiotype immunoglobulin and a late-acting B cell maturation factor, are required for BH-dependent helper activity. The relationships of these results to current concepts of B cell activation mechanisms and the possible association of Ly-1 BH cells with autoimmunity are discussed.  相似文献

The dependence of antiesteratic activity on the structure of insecticides (RO)2P(O)SCH(COOEt)SP(O)(OR)2 (I) and (RO)2P(O)SCH(COOEt)OP(S)(OR)2 (II) was examined. Nonlinear regression equations (parabolic and bilinear) "hydrophobicity-antiesteratic activity" were derived. Basing on the studies of the relationships between hydrophobicity and individual constants, the detailed mechanisms were proposed for the interaction of type (I) and (II) compounds with the esterase active centers. The mechanisms implicate different kinds of sorbtion for compounds of type I and II. Applicability of bilinear models, similar to that of Kubinyi type, for analyzing the structure-antienzyme activity dependences was demonstrated. Thus, several equations were obtained starting from the literature data on inhibition of esterases with diverse organophosphorus compounds.  相似文献

To develop an understanding of the structure-activity relationships for the inhibition of orthopoxviruses by nucleoside analogues, a variety of novel chemical entities were synthesized. These included a series of pyrimidine 5-hypermodified acyclic nucleoside analogues based upon recently discovered new leads, and some previously unknown "double-headed" or "abbreviated" nucleosides. None of the synthetic products possessed significant activity against two representative orthopoxviruses; namely, vaccinia virus and cowpox virus. They were also devoid of significant activity against a battery of other DNA and RNA viruses. So far as the results with the orthopoxviruses and herpes viruses, the results may point to the necessity for nucleoside analogues 5'-phosphorylation for antiviral efficacy.  相似文献

Nonhuman primates use greeting behaviors as nonaggressive communicatory signals in multiple social contexts. Adult male mantled howlers (Alouatta palliata) perform a ritual greeting that has been associated with bond-strengthening functions. The aim of this study is to explore the greeting patterns of male howlers living on Agaltepec Island, Mexico. Specifically, we analyzed the relationships between greetings and several individual, relational, and contextual variables, such as the expression of affiliation and agonism, dominance rank, age, kinship relationships, spatial organization, activity patterns, and subgrouping patterns. Greetings were more frequent between males with closer dominance ranks. Among those dyads that greeted at least once, dominant males initiated greetings more frequently than less-dominant males. On the other hand, more greetings were observed when one of the participants had recently returned to a subgroup and during locomotion. On the basis of these results, we propose that on Agaltepec greetings are a conflict management mechanism used between males of similar ranks. The fission-fusion social system of this group of howlers allows males with conflicting interests to remain separated, and greetings may reduce tension during fusion events.  相似文献

A study is made of the relationships between electronic structures and carcinogenic activities of a series of molecules of which the parent is tricycloquinazoline. The carcinogens amongst these molecules do not belong to any of the better known classes of carcinogens and small variations between the members of the series produce marked differences in carcinogenic activity. Using semi.empiriW methods of pi-molecular orbital theory calculations have been carried out on the electronic structures of a number of the tricycloquinazdline series and the effect of substituents on the charge distribution is examined through the calculation of atom atom polarizabilities. The relation of these results to the carcinogenic behaviour of the tricycloquinazolines add the form of the variation of carcinogenic activity amongst the series of molecules under study is examined critically and the hypothesis that the specificity of tricycloquinazoline carcinogenesis could be due to electrostatic interactions between DNA base-pairs and tricycloqumazoline molecules intercalated into the DNA helix is formulated. Theoretical calculations to test this hypothesis are presented. Although the magnitudes of the electrostatic interactions are large enough to be significant, no general correlation in support of the hypothesis is found. Ionization potentials of tricycloquinazolines are also calculated and these support the view that there is no correlation between ionization potential and carcinogenic activity.  相似文献

The mutants referred to as facultative dominant lethals were selected in the progeny of gamma-irradiated Drosophila males. The mutant males were viable and fertile, though their crosses with females of the yellow line yielded no daughters. The mutations obtained differed from the common mutations by (1) extremely varying penetrance of F1 hybrids from crosses with various lines; (2) the uncertain relationships between the mutant and normal alleles; (3) the different expression in somatic and germ cells; (4) the dependence of the expression on the sex of the parent carrying the donor mutations; (5) the mass morphosis formation and (6) the frequent reversal to the norm. These mutations are assigned to the regulatory group and their specific expression (see above) can be helpful in identifying regulatory gene mutations. We assume that the specific expression of the mutations studied is related to specific properties of the regulatory genes. These properties are as follows: (1) only one out of two homologous regulatory genes located on one homolog is in an active state, (2) in the haploid chromosome set the regulatory gene is represented by several alleles (cys-alleles); (3) only one allele ensures the regulatory gene activity.  相似文献

Metazoa are one of the great monophyletic groups of organisms. They comprise several major groups of organisms readily recognizable based on their anatomy. These major groups include the Bilateria (animals with bilateral symmetry), Cnidaria (jellyfish, corals and other closely related animals), Porifera (sponges), Ctenophores (comb jellies) and a phylum currently made up of a single species, the Placozoa. Attempts to systematize the relationships of these major groups as well as to determine relationships within the groups have been made for nearly two centuries. Many of the attempts have led to frustration, because of a lack of resolution between and within groups. Other attempts have led to "a new animal phylogeny". Now, a study by Dunn et al., using the expresssed sequence tag (EST) approach to obtaining high-throughput large phylogenetic matrices, presents an "even newer" animal phylogeny. There are two major aspects of this study that should be of interest to the general biological community. First, the methods used by the authors to generate their phylogenetic hypotheses call for close examination. Second, the relationships of animal taxa in their resultant trees also prompt further discussion.  相似文献

Distinguishing "or" from "and" and the case for historical identification   总被引:1,自引:1,他引:0  
The adequacy of a probabilistic interpretation must be judged according to the nature of the event, or thing, being inferred. For example, conditional (frequency) probability is not admissible in the inference of phylogeny, because basic statements of common ancestry do not fulfill the requirements of the relations specified by the probability calculus. The probabilities of the situation peculiar to the time and place of origin of species are unique. Moreover, according to evolutionary theory, an event of species diversification is necessarily unique, because species are parts of a replicator continuum—species arise from ancestral species. Also, these probabilities cannot be ascertained, because the relevant situation cannot be repeated—it is unique. Finally, the applicability of conditional (frequency) probability is denied, because events of common ancestry have already occurred—there is nothing to predict. However, hypotheses of species relationships can be identified objectively according to the degree to which they have survived simultaneous testing with critical evidence, not with generally confirming evidence. The most parsimonious hypothesis of species relationships represents the least disconfirmed, best supported, proposition among the alternatives being compared. That hypothesis does not, however, deserve any special epistemological status beyond serving as the focus of the next round of testing.  相似文献

系统发育研究中“长枝吸引”现象概述   总被引:1,自引:0,他引:1  
黎一苇  于黎  张亚平 《遗传》2007,29(6):659-667
系统发育研究(phylogeny)不仅有助于重建地球所有生物体的进化历史, 而且还可以揭示进化生物学领域中的一些基本问题。清晰了解各生物物种进化历程及不同物种之间的进化关系, 是进一步研究和探索生物学其他学科的基础。但是现今广泛应用的所有系统发育分析方法都存在一定的局限性, 在一定程度上不能有效消除各种误差, 从而不能客观地处理和分析数据, 也就不能成功重建生物进化历程, 真实反映物种进化关系。系统发育研究中, “长枝吸引” (Long-branch Attraction, LBA)假象是最为困扰研究者的问题。文章从“长枝吸引”问题的产生原由、检测方法以及消除策略等多个方面进行详尽概述, 并通过列举典型实例, 阐述了解决“长枝吸引”问题的途径。  相似文献

d-Aspartate oxidase (DDO) and d-amino acid oxidase (DAO) are flavin adenine dinucleotide (FAD)-containing flavoproteins that catalyze the oxidative deamination of d-amino acids. While several functionally and structurally important amino acid residues have been identified in the DAO protein, little is known about the structure–function relationships of DDO. In the search for a potent DDO inhibitor as a novel tool for investigating its structure–function relationships, a large number of biologically active compounds of microbial origin were screened for their ability to inhibit the enzymatic activity of mouse DDO. We discovered several compounds that inhibited the activity of mouse DDO, and one of the compounds identified, thiolactomycin (TLM), was then characterized and evaluated as a novel DDO inhibitor. TLM reversibly inhibited the activity of mouse DDO with a mixed type of inhibition more efficiently than meso-tartrate and malonate, known competitive inhibitors of mammalian DDOs. The selectivity of TLM was investigated using various DDOs and DAOs, and it was found that TLM inhibits not only DDO, but also DAO. Further experiments with apoenzymes of DDO and DAO revealed that TLM is most likely to inhibit the activities of DDO and DAO by competition with both the substrate and the coenzyme, FAD. Structural models of mouse DDO/TLM complexes supported this finding. The binding mode of TLM to DDO was validated further by site-directed mutagenesis of an active site residue, Arg-237. Collectively, our findings show that TLM is a novel, active site-directed DDO inhibitor that will be useful for elucidating the molecular details of the active site environment of DDO.  相似文献

Sequence requirements in the catalytic core of the "10-23" DNA enzyme   总被引:7,自引:0,他引:7  
A systematic mutagenesis study of the "10-23" DNA enzyme was performed to analyze the sequence requirements of its catalytic domain. Therefore, each of the 15 core nucleotides was substituted separately by the remaining three naturally occurring nucleotides. Changes at the borders of the catalytic domain led to a dramatic loss of enzymatic activity, whereas several nucleotides in between could be exchanged without severe effects. Thymidine at position 8 had the lowest degree of conservation and its substitution by any of the other three nucleotides caused only a minor loss of activity. In addition to the standard nucleotides (adenosine, guanosine, thymidine, or cytidine) modified nucleotides were used to gain further information about the role of individual functional groups. Again, thymidine at position 8 as well as some other nucleotides could be substituted by inosine without severe effects on the catalytic activity. For two positions, additional experiments with 2-aminopurine and deoxypurine, respectively, were performed to obtain information about the specific role of functional groups. In addition to sequence-function relationships of the DNA enzyme, this study provides information about suitable sites to introduce modified nucleotides for further functional studies or for internal stabilization of the DNA enzyme against endonucleolytic attack.  相似文献

Flavonoids, naturally occurring phenolic compounds, have recently been studied extensively for their antioxidant properties. The structure-antioxidant activity relationships (SAR) of flavonoids have been evaluated against different free radicals, but "ferric reducing antioxidant power" (FRAP) assay, which determines directly the reducing capacity of a compound, has not been used for this purpose. In this study, the antioxidant activities of 18 structurally different flavonoids were evaluated by FRAP assay modified to be used in 96-well microplates. Furthermore, their oxidation potentials were also measured, which were in the range of +0.3 V (myricetin) to +1.2 V (5-hydroxy flavone) and were in good agreement with FRAP assay results. Quercetin, fisetin and myricetin had the lowest oxidation potentials and appeared the most active compounds in FRAP assay and were 3.02, 2.52 and 2.28 times more active than Trolox, respectively. Indications were found that the o-dihydroxy structure in the B ring and the 3-hydroxy group and 2,3-double bond in the C ring give the highest contribution to the antioxidant activity.  相似文献

This article gives brief accounts of affinal relations, marriage, gender roles, and long-term lineage relationships among Toba Bataks of Samosir, north Sumatra, Indonesia. Ethnographic data, presented in tandem with data on the Kachin and similar cultures, are used to call into question the use of the term "wife-taker" as opposed to "wife-receiver," as it is generally employed with reference to the groom, his family, and lineage-mates, in glossing a major conceptual category of Southeast Asian hinterland societies that have preferred matrilateral cross-cousin marriage. It is argued that "wife-taker" is more distorting of Batak practice and of their system of values than "wife-receiver."  相似文献

Doctors who become patients due to serious illnesses face many challenges related to issues of identity, work, and professionalism. In-depth interviews with such doctors reveal the complex ways in which illness threatens identity in these professionals. In comparison with "medical student's disease," these doctors now exhibit "post-residency disease"-minimizing physical symptoms that are in fact present, leading to decreases in care sought. Doctors often feel they are somehow invulnerable to disease and have to remain strong, not burdening others. Many describe themselves as "workaholics," which can prove to be a double-edged sword, posing problems as well as providing benefits. This professional commitment could interfere with preventive health behaviors and with "practicing what they preach." Some view their illness with their "medical self" - as if they were a physician observing another patient rather than themselves. These doctors often support their approach by choosing a colleague as a doctor who will not challenge them, thereby establishing a "denial system" as opposed to a support system. These doctor-patients confront difficult issues of how much their physicianhood is an identity or an activity, illustrating the intricate relationships and tensions between work, identity, professionalism, and health in contemporary medicine.  相似文献

Gelonin, a single-chain protein which inactivates eukaryotic ribosomes, becomes split into peptides when incubated with SDS. During the chromatographic purification of gelonin on carboxymethylcellulose three overlapping peaks emerge in the gelonin elution region, containing three proteins with small differences in apparent molecular weight (31,500, 30,000 and 29,200). All three proteins are endowed with inhibitory activity on protein synthesis and with proteinase activity, although with different specific activities, and all three give rise to the same peptides upon incubation with SDS, suggesting that they are isoforms of gelonin. The gelonin-associated proteinase acts only on gelonin, while it is inactive on the most common substrates for endoproteinases. The proteolytic activity is not inhibited by inhibitors of serine- or SH-proteinases, while it is completely abolished by chelating agents. Divalent cations restore the proteolytic activity inhibited by EDTA. The stability of the proteinase activity on exposure of gelonin to extreme values of pH or to prolonged incubation has been investigated. The inhibitory activity on protein synthesis and the proteinase activity are differently affected by these treatments.  相似文献

Humans react strongly to unfairness, sometimes rejecting inequitable proposals even if this sacrifices personal financial gain. Here we explored whether emotional dispositions--trait tendencies to experience positive or negative feelings--shape the rejection of unfair financial offers. Participants played an Ultimatum Game, where the division of a sum of money is proposed and the player can accept or reject this offer. Individuals high in trait positivity and low in trait negativity rejected more unfair offers. These relationships could not be explained by existing accounts which argue that rejection behaviour results from a failure to regulate negative emotions, or serves to arbitrate social relationships and identity. Instead, the relationship between dispositional affect and rejection behaviour may be underpinned by perceived self worth, with those of a positive disposition believing that they are "worth more than that" and those of a negative disposition resigning themselves to "taking the crumbs from under the table".  相似文献

Extensive skeletal pneumaticity (air-filled bone) is a distinguishing feature of birds. The proportion of the skeleton that is pneumatized varies considerably among the >10,000 living species, with notable patterns including increases in larger bodied forms, and reductions in birds employing underwater pursuit diving as a foraging strategy. I assess the relationship between skeletal pneumaticity and body mass and foraging ecology, using a dataset of the diverse "waterbird" clade that encompasses a broad range of trait variation. Inferred changes in pneumaticity and body mass are congruent across different estimates of phylogeny, whereas pursuit diving has evolved independently between two and five times. Phylogenetic regressions detected positive relationships between body mass and pneumaticity, and negative relationships between pursuit diving and pneumaticity, whether independent variables are considered in isolation or jointly. Results are generally consistent across different estimates of topology and branch lengths. "Predictive" analyses reveal that several pursuit divers (loons, penguins, cormorants, darters) are significantly apneumatic compared to their relatives, and provide an example of how phylogenetic information can increase the statistical power to detect taxa that depart from established trait correlations. These findings provide the strongest quantitative comparative support yet for classical hypotheses regarding the evolution of avian skeletal pneumaticity.  相似文献
